Robert Moore
Thorpe
Aug 26, 1929 — Nov 7, 2024
Robert Moore (Bob) Thorpe passed away on November 7,2024 in Marietta, GA at the age of 95.
Bob grew up in Cherry Tree, PA. In 1949 he enlisted in the Navy, serving four years into the Korean War. After his discharge, he married Patricia Weaver in 1953. He graduated as a mechanical engineer from the University of Pittsburgh and began his first job with Ford Motor Company, receiving two patents while there. Later he worked for Bell Aerospace, helping in the development of the Surface Effect Ships, specifically the SES 100B.
He was an active volunteer in church and a lifelong member of the Masonic Lodge. After retirement Bob continued to serve the church, as well as substitute teach at local high schools. He became a Master Gardener and, as always, continued his love of restoring cars-especially his MG TDs.
He is preceded in death by his wife Pat. He is survived by his son Scott Thorpe and his wife Rhonda and his daughter Kathy Milburn and her husband Fred, five grandchildren, and 9 great grandchildren.
